Summary: StreamAppender should not propagate exceptions to caller

StreamAppender#append currently propagates any exceptions while sending messages to the underlying logging system to the calling code. Since users don't expect log statements to throw exceptions, this can cause unexpected failures.
We should catch exceptions and log to stderr instead.
